HENDERSON, Nevada - The Cal State Fullerton Titans women's basketball season came to an end on Wednesday as the Titans dropped an 81-56 game against the No. 5 seeded UC Davis Aggies in the Big West Championship First Round.
The Titans could not match with a hot shooting UC Davis side that shot 54.5% from the floor including going 17-for-32 from beyond the arc. Evanne Turner dropped a career-high 29 points on the Titans with 7 triples.
For the Titans, senior guard Fujika Nimmo had her best game all season in the final collegiate game of her career. Â
Nimmo led the Titans with 22 points on 9-for-16 shooting including going 4-for-7 from beyond the arc. Â Gabi Vidmar had 12 points including three steals in her final game as a Titan and Ashlee Lewis had 10 points along with 9 rebounds.
UC Davis jumped to an early 9-2 lead after drilling three-pointers to start the game. Â The Titans went on an 8-0 run to take a 10-9 lead over the Aggies behind Gabi Vidmar and Fujika Nimmo. Â

In the second quarter, the Aggies separated themselves from the Titans after outscoring the Titans 29-to-14. The Aggies scored the 15 points of the period to build a 32-12 lead before
Fujika Nimmo finally got a basket back for the Titans. Â Evanne Turner and
Fujika Nimmo traded off three-point baskets twice before the Aggies built a 20 point lead before the first half ended.
Ashlee Lewis scored the first basket coming out of the halftime break. Â
The Titans continued to fight as Nimmo,
Aixchel Hernandez,
Gabi Vidmar, and
Brielle Minor scored for the Titans. Â The Aggies only outscored the Titans by 4 points (18-to-14) in the third quarter.
Minor started the final quarter by taking it to the rack and drawing a foul and completing the 3-point play.
 The Aggies built a 30-point lead before the Titans began chipping away at it. Â
Fujika Nimmo scored 7 of her 22 points in the final quarter including the final two baskets of the game.
The Titans finished the season with an overall 10-21 record and 6-14 conference record. Â The Titans had four seniors participate in the senior ceremony (
Kathryn Neff,
Ashlee Lewis,
Fujika Nimmo, and
Gabi Vidmar). Â However,
Ashlee Lewis is returning for her 5th year next year with the final covid-year exemption remaining next season.
